If installation of a properly grounded wall receptacle is
impossible at the time of installation, consult your local electri-
cal inspector for permission to connect a temporary adapter (with
polarized blades) which could be plugged into your present 2-
wire receptacle; however, this is not recommended.
If this is
done, you must attach the lug and/or the green adapter wire
to the receptacle cover plate screw. Ground from it to a
grounded metal cold water pipe* (See Fig.10). Do not ground
to a gas supply pipe.
You must permanently ground the adapter
before connecting the appliance to the power supply.

CAUTION:

Attaching the adapter ground wire to wall
receptacle cover screw does not ground the appli-
ance unless the cover screw is grounded through
house wiring.

If there is any doubt as to whether the wall
receptacle is properly grounded, the customer
should have it checked by a qualified electri-
cian.

* Cold water pipe must have metal continuity the electrical
ground and cannot be interrupted by plastic, rubber or
other electrically insulating connectors (including water
meter or pump) without adding a jumper wire at these con-
nections (See Fig.9).
